How We Work
Our clients are private. Names, addresses, and identifying details of completed residences are never published without written consent. References are offered to qualified prospective clients on request and reviewed individually.
Every engagement begins with a private consultation, proceeds through measured specification, and concludes with installation by the studio's own team. No project is rushed; no project is delegated to a sub-contractor outside the studio.
Olga Rechdouni, ASID, is the principal on every project. Clients work directly with the designer who specified their drapery — from first measurement through final dressing of the folds.
A meaningful share of the studio's work is trade — specified alongside an interior designer or architect of record. Shop drawings, fabric specifications, and installation coordination are documented on every project.
Representative Design Outcomes
Summaries written by the studio to describe the kinds of briefs it is regularly retained to solve. These are not client testimonials. “Full-residence custom drapery program delivered from concept through installation — coordinated with the interior designer of record and installed by the studio's own crew.”
“Acoustic drapery specification for an estate with tall ceilings and large glass walls — heavyweight interlined panels sized to the architecture and specified to soften reflected sound while carrying the room's design vocabulary.”
“Outdoor drapery for a covered patio — weather-resistant panels specified for privacy, filtered shade, and an architectural line at the loggia.”
“Window treatment program for a family residence with close-neighbor exposure — layered privacy specification that preserved daylight while resolving direct sightlines.”
“Floor-to-ceiling drapery for a modern penthouse — ceiling-mounted track, ripple-fold heading, and hardware coordinated with the architectural finishes.”
“Primary-suite blackout program with layered sheer and light-seal detailing — specified for a residence with early-morning east exposure and evening street-lighting infiltration.”
“Sheer drapery specified for oceanfront glass — filtered daylight and daytime privacy without compromising the view corridor.”
“Motorized Roman shade specification coordinated with the home's smart-home integrator — commissioned on the existing keypad scenes at install.”
“Remote-managed custom drapery engagement — measurement coordination, fabric review, and specification handled by video consultation with local installation coordinated on delivery.”
